Como criar bases de dados

Disponível somente no TrabalhosFeitos
  • Páginas : 7 (1520 palavras )
  • Download(s) : 0
  • Publicado : 18 de abril de 2013
Ler documento completo
Amostra do texto
Relatório
Trabalho Prático de Base de Dados

* Licenciatura em Ciência da Informação

-------------------------------------------------
Resumo

O presente trabalho tem como objectivo principal descrever as várias fases de desenvolvimento de um exemplo de base de dados direccionada a uma Biblioteca Municipal. Este relatório contém as fases já mencionadas, descritas pormenorizadamente:descrição do problema, que indica qual a necessidade da criação de uma base de dados de requisição de documentos para a Biblioteca em questão; o modelo de classes, que descreve o problema num diagrama UML; o modelo relacional, com a identificação das chaves primárias e das devidas relações; a descrição da construção das tabelas com os relativos dados e respectivas colunas no Microsoft Access; aapresentação de cinco interrogações e respectivas respostas à base de dados, estando as mesmas apresentadas em linguagem natural, em SQL e em álgebra relacional; e, por último, a descrição da construção da interface da base de dados, que consistiu na elaboração de uma série de formulários para introdução de dados.

-------------------------------------------------
Introdução

Esterelatório foi elaborado no âmbito da disciplina de Base de Dados leccionada no segundo semestre do terceiro ano da Licenciatura em Ciência da Informação.
Este trabalho prático pretende pôr em prática os conteúdos leccionados no decorrer das aulas e o consequente relatório pretende descrever as várias fases do mesmo trabalho, que complementa os seguintes objectivos: a utilização de sistemas de gestão debases de dados e a avaliação da compreensão das técnicas aprendidas.
O trabalho prático referido compreende as precedentes fases: descrição do problema; elaboração do modelo de classes; tradução para esquema relacional; construção da base da dados; elaborar 5 interrogações à base de dados; e, preparação da interface.
O tema em que se baseia este trabalho é sobre a organização da informaçãona Biblioteca Municipal de Valença, no entanto, centra-se sobretudo no processo de requisição de documentos, bem como na utilização dos serviços disponíveis.

1. -------------------------------------------------
Descrição do problema
Pretende-se construir uma base de dados para uma Biblioteca, neste caso para a Biblioteca Municipal de Valença (tabela BIBLIOTECA).
Esta base de dadosreúne as condições e dados suficientes para organizar a estrutura da biblioteca e facilitar o acesso à informação necessária.
Sendo assim o objectivo passa pela gestão dos utilizadores (tabela UTILIZADOR), com todos os seus dados e os seus devidos cartões de utentes (tabela CARTÃO DE UTENTE), os documentos (tabela DOCUMENTOS) existentes e as suas requisições (tabela REQUISITA) e todos os serviços(tabela SERVIÇOS) disponíveis e as suas utilizações (tabela USUFRUI).
Cada utilizador deve estar devidamente identificado e registado na base de dados, com nome, morada, data de nascimento email e é assim atribuída um número de utilizador; cada utilizador tem associado um cartão de utente para poder realizar requisições e usufruir dos variados serviços da biblioteca, este cartão tem um número,uma validade e pode ser individual ou colectivo; a Biblioteca possui uma lista dos documentos existentes, estes documentos encontram-se identificados por um número de documento, pelo nome/título, pela quota, a sua data de publicação, o autor e o suporte (filme, microfilme, ficheiro áudio ou livro);a Biblioteca tem ao dispor dos seu utilizadores 3 serviços de excelência: um auditório, uma área deexposições e um espaço internet, de que os seus utentes podem usufruir; por fim, esta base de dados complementa a função crucial do processo de requisições onde o utilizador e o documento requisitado é devidamente enumerado.
O modelo de classes que tenta representar este problema é apresentado de seguida.

2. -------------------------------------------------
Modelo de classes

3....
tracking img